Introduction to the Yasawa Archipelago
Nestled in the azure waters of the South Pacific, the Yasawa Archipelago is a stunning chain of islands located in Fiji. Comprising around 20 volcanic islands, this tropical paradise is renowned for its breathtaking landscapes, pristine beaches, and vibrant marine life. Getting Started: Planning Your Island Hopping Adventure
Before embarking on your island hopping journey, it’s essential to plan your itinerary carefully. The Yasawa Islands are accessible by boat or seaplane, with regular services departing from Nadi, Fiji’s main international gateway. Consider the time of year, as the dry season from May to October is ideal for travel due to its pleasant weather. Must-See Spots in the Yasawa Archipelago
Blue Lagoon
One of the most iconic locations within the archipelago, the Blue Lagoon is renowned for its crystal-clear waters and vibrant coral reefs. Visitors can engage in snorkeling or simply relax on the pristine sandy shores. The Blue Lagoon is a quintessential stop on any island hopping itinerary, offering a serene escape into nature’s beauty.
Sawa-i-Lau Caves
Explore the mystical Sawa-i-Lau Caves, a geological wonder steeped in Fijian legend. Accessible by boat, these limestone caves are famous for their submerged chambers and unique rock formations. Cultural Immersion in Fijian Villages
Engaging with the local culture is a highlight of any visit to the Yasawa Islands. Many villages welcome tourists to experience traditional Fijian life.
